Method

Preparation

1

Prepare the Glass

Select a highball glass or a rocks glass. Fill the glass with ice cubes to chill it while you prepare the drink.

2

Mix the Ingredients

In a cocktail shaker, add 2 oz of tequila, 3 oz of grapefruit juice, 1 oz of fresh lime juice, and 0.5 oz of agave syrup.

3

Shake the Mixture

Fill the shaker with ice and shake vigorously for about 15 seconds until well chilled.

Serving

4

Strain into Glass

Remove the ice from the chilled glass and strain the mixture from the shaker into the glass filled with fresh ice.

5

Garnish

Garnish the drink with a lime wedge and a slice of grapefruit on the rim of the glass.

6

Serve

Your Paloma is ready to be enjoyed! Serve immediately and enjoy the refreshing flavors.
